Clean Technologies | Scope Update

The scope of Clean Technologies (ISSN: 2571-8797) has been updated under the guidance of the Editor-in-Chief, Prof. Dr. Patricia Luis, for better development and further clarification. The original scope and the updated version are listed below:

Original Scope Updated Scope
• Clean and Low-Carbon Energy • Clean and Low-Carbon Energy
• Energy Recovery • Energy Recovery
• Carbon Capture and Reutilization • Carbon Capture and Utilization (CCU)/Carbon Capture and Sequestration (CCS)
• Circular Economy and Circular Society • Decarbonization of Industry
• Green/Sustainable Chemistry • Decarbonization of Mobility Sector
• Cleaner Alternatives to Unsustainable Practices • Circular Economy and Circular Society
• Sustainable Treatment of Solid Waste and Wastewaters • Technology for Sustainable Cities and Responsible Citizens
• Recycling • Sustainable Treatment of Solid Waste & Recycling
• Life Cycle Assessment of Products and Processes • Sustainable Treatment of Wastewater (special emphasis on treatment of contaminants of emerging concern, e.g., pharmaceuticals, cytotoxins, food additives, PFAS/PFOS/PFOA/etc., microplastics, hormones)
• Cleaner Production and Technical Processes • Clean water and Sanitation
• Membrane Technology • Green/Sustainable Chemistry and Chemical Processes
  • Life Cycle Assessment of Products and Processes
  • Membrane Technology
